Free Android emulator dedicated to bring the best experience for users to play Android games and apps on PC and Mac. Users can assign keyboard and mouse to the APK games and Apps with simple key mapping and enjoy easy access to functions like location, adjust volume, and many more.

Key features: * A simple interface that makes the app easy to use. * Intuitive keyboard mapping for app and game controls. * Support for multiple control devices. * A stable and reliable platform. * Support three Android systems, Android 4.4.2, Android 5.1.1 and Android 7.1.2

It supports various gaming-specific features such as script recording, multi-drive, multi-instance, controller support, and more. With Nox Player, you can choose the device you want to emulate and the CPU and the amount of RAM it can use.

It is based on Android Nougat 7.0 and sports the Material UI. But one factor where Nox Player truly scores over Bluestacks is root access. If you’ve ever tried rooting Bluestacks, you’d know that it is a tedious task. But on Nox Player, you simply have to enable a toggle in the settings, and poof! – you’re rooted. That’s how simple Nox Player is for you.
